Yes, Plaça de Catalunya serves as Barcelona’s central transportation hub, making it exceptionally convenient to visit major attractions. Multiple metro lines (L1, L2, L3) connect to key sites within 10 minutes, including the Gothic Quarter, Las Ramblas, Sagrada Família, and Montjuïc Park. Bus routes are also extensive, with direct services to most destinations. On-site taxi stands and electric bike rental stations offer additional mobility options. Even on foot, attractions like the Museu Nacional d’Art de Catalunya and Picasso Museum are reachable in 15–25 minutes. Overall, this area is the perfect base for exploring Barcelona efficiently, saving time and transport costs.
Near Plaça de Catalunya, several highly rated restaurants stand out. Can Culleretes, founded in 1790, is one of Barcelona’s oldest establishments, famed for authentic Catalan cuisine such as Escalivada (roasted vegetables) and Calçotada (grilled onion feast). Another favorite is La Tapería del Raval, blending Spanish and Mediterranean flavors with creative tapas and artisanal wines in a cozy, artsy setting. For modern innovation, Cinc Sentits offers a molecular gastronomy experience using local ingredients in an immersive dining format. All are within walking distance, forming a vibrant culinary itinerary complemented by nearby cafés and dessert spots.
